Gault&Millau's review 2026

Bertrand Grébaut’s seafood counter is just as good as the rest of the restaurant, offering a genuine taste of the coast right in the heart of the 11th arrondissement. An airy setting, high-quality ingredients, and straightforward recipes come together at Clamato, a place you’ll return to for the Brest clams, wild clams from Le Croisic, a plate of cuttlefish tagliatelle with cashew cream, and Sichuan oil; skate wing with Grenoble-style sauce; roasted monkfish with bouillabaisse sauce, rouille, and baby potatoes; and a tartlet with maple syrup and whipped cream. Excellent wine selection.
